Photo by Elizabeth Sanders

Search Hotels Near Mayflower Beach, Dennis
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Our top choices for Mayflower Beach hotels

The Escape Inn
The Escape Inn8.7 km from Mayflower Beach
9.4 out of 10, Exceptional, (668 reviews)
The price is Rp1.346.806
Rp1.541.482 total
includes taxes & fees
29 Jan - 30 Jan

Ambassador Inn & Suites
Ambassador Inn & Suites8.6 km from Mayflower Beach
8.6 out of 10, Excellent, (635 reviews)

Brewster by the Sea Inn
Brewster by the Sea Inn8.4 km from Mayflower Beach
9.8 out of 10, Exceptional, (172 reviews)
The price is Rp5.097.472
Rp5.834.090 total
includes taxes & fees
30 Jan - 31 Jan

Anchor In Distinctive Waterfront Lodging
Anchor In Distinctive Waterfront Lodging10.9 km from Mayflower Beach
9.4 out of 10, Exceptional, (1,008 reviews)
The price is Rp1.981.139
Rp2.747.145 total
includes taxes & fees
29 Jan - 30 Jan

Bayside Resort Hotel
Bayside Resort Hotel10 km from Mayflower Beach
8.8 out of 10, Excellent, (1,545 reviews)
The price is Rp1.592.960
Rp2.015.137 total
includes taxes & fees
1 Feb - 2 Feb

All Seasons Resort, Trademark Collection by Wyndham
All Seasons Resort, Trademark Collection by Wyndham8.8 km from Mayflower Beach
8.4 out of 10, Very good, (318 reviews)
The price is Rp1.433.664
Rp1.841.965 total
includes taxes & fees
1 Feb - 2 Feb

Hampton Inn & Suites Cape Cod-West Yarmouth
Hampton Inn & Suites Cape Cod-West Yarmouth10 km from Mayflower Beach
8.8 out of 10, Excellent, (1,000 reviews)
The price is Rp1.912.812
Rp2.189.214 total
includes taxes & fees
8 Feb - 9 Feb

Fairfield Inn & Suites by Marriott Cape Cod Hyannis
Fairfield Inn & Suites by Marriott Cape Cod Hyannis10.2 km from Mayflower Beach
8.8 out of 10, Excellent, (674 reviews)
The price is Rp2.097.750
Rp2.400.876 total
includes taxes & fees
7 Feb - 8 Feb

Ocean Club on Smuggler's Beach
Ocean Club on Smuggler's Beach10.9 km from Mayflower Beach
9.2 out of 10, Wonderful, (1,001 reviews)
The price is Rp2.498.432
Rp3.037.691 total
includes taxes & fees
11 Feb - 12 Feb

The Cove at Yarmouth by Westgate Resorts
The Cove at Yarmouth by Westgate Resorts9.9 km from Mayflower Beach
9.2 out of 10, Wonderful, (248 reviews)
The price is Rp2.160.305
Rp2.472.469 total
includes taxes & fees
29 Jan - 30 Jan

Aiden by Best Western Cape Cod - West Yarmouth
Aiden by Best Western Cape Cod - West Yarmouth10.2 km from Mayflower Beach
8.0 out of 10, Very good, (1,001 reviews)
The price is Rp1.624.987
Rp1.859.797 total
includes taxes & fees
5 Feb - 6 Feb

Courtyard By Marriott Cape Cod Hyannis
Courtyard By Marriott Cape Cod Hyannis10.3 km from Mayflower Beach
8.8 out of 10, Excellent, (490 reviews)
The price is Rp2.109.414
Rp2.414.224 total
includes taxes & fees
7 Feb - 8 Feb

Cape Sands Inn
Cape Sands Inn9.9 km from Mayflower Beach
8.2 out of 10, Very good, (1,020 reviews)
The price is Rp1.250.557
Rp1.431.149 total
includes taxes & fees
29 Jan - 30 Jan

Margaritaville Resort Cape Cod
Margaritaville Resort Cape Cod10.6 km from Mayflower Beach
8.8 out of 10, Excellent, (437 reviews)
The price is Rp4.512.269
Rp6.124.009 total
includes taxes & fees
13 Feb - 14 Feb

Doubletree by Hilton Cape Cod - Hyannis
Doubletree by Hilton Cape Cod - Hyannis10.2 km from Mayflower Beach
8.4 out of 10, Very good, (887 reviews)
The price is Rp1.911.217
Rp2.187.388 total
includes taxes & fees
7 Feb - 8 Feb

Holiday Inn Hyannis by IHG
Holiday Inn Hyannis by IHG10.4 km from Mayflower Beach
8.2 out of 10, Very good, (987 reviews)
The price is Rp1.911.552
Rp2.187.772 total
includes taxes & fees
2 Feb - 3 Feb

Comfort Inn Hyannis - Cape Cod
Comfort Inn Hyannis - Cape Cod10.9 km from Mayflower Beach
8.0 out of 10, Very good, (1,000 reviews)
The price is Rp1.644.941
Rp1.882.636 total
includes taxes & fees
26 Feb - 27 Feb

Cape Cod Hotel
Cape Cod Hotel10.6 km from Mayflower Beach
7.4 out of 10, Good, (1,000 reviews)
The price is Rp1.643.264
Rp2.072.625 total
includes taxes & fees
11 Feb - 12 Feb

Courtyard Resort
Courtyard Resort11.3 km from Mayflower Beach
8.4 out of 10, Very good, (54 reviews)
The price is Rp1.827.712
Rp2.091.817 total
includes taxes & fees
1 Feb - 2 Feb
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Mayflower Beach Hotel Reviews

Bayside Resort Hotel
10/10 Excellent































































